- ALWAYS create a backup of the control unit (NLSR) before the firmware update !

- Before performing a firmware update make sure that no system components are faulty. During the update automatic adjustments are made, which may produce undesirable results because of faulty system components.

- When the central unit is restarted all open web pages of the system must be closed !
During restart buffered information is lost and save operations will result in a partial save thus corrupting the system configuration.

- The feature GLT Gateway now requires a feature key. Without a valid key, the GLT Gateway support is disabled.
  You can request the key using your order number and serial number of the system.

*** Offline-Tool ***

- The Offline-Tool contains a demo configuration (Zip archive), which can be installed on demand.

- The Administration menu has the new page "Import / Export ...". This page contains two new features:

  - Export a lamp list in CSV format, which can be opened in a spreadsheet directly or via data import.
    The list contains following lamp data:

      circuit    (circuit number 1..96)
      lamp       (lamp number 1..20)
      position   (position text)
      mode       (lamp operation mode; maintained, non-maintained, )
      monitoring (lamp monitoring: M - lamp monitoring, CM - power monitoring, OFF - monitoring disabled)
      map        (index of the floorplan 0..99)
      x_pos      (lamp position, pixel-X-coordinate)
      y_pos      (lamp Position, pixel-Y-coordinate)

  - Import a lamp list in CSV format (see above). The function checks the format and the range of values.
    The lamp configuration is overwritten with the contents of the list. 

    Before importing, a backup of the system configuration is recommended.

    The function is intended for fast import of position text and visualization data. The lamp coordinates (x_pos, y_pos) on a map can be identified with a external graphics program (e.g. paint.net) and entered by hand into the CSV list. The placement of a large number of lamps is simplified and requires little rework in the web interface (fine placement).
    The CSV data can be processed in a spreadsheet (no Offline-Tool required).

    Recommended workflow:
	- Backup the system and import it into the Offline-Tool
	- Start the Offline-Tool and export the existing configuration (CSV) via the web interface	
    - Create a working copy of the CSV file
    - Modify working copy
    - Import working copy

    If problems arise during import or afterwards, the configuration can be restored from the backup or CSV (original data).

Changes in firmware 1.7.4 (1013):
---------------------------------

- Hardware versions HW19, HW20 and HW21 are supported.

- Booting the NLSR can be paused to create a backup of the NLSR via FTP (break boot loops). Once the text "F1" appears on the LCD boot screen on the top left corner, the key F1 must be pressed and held. When the boot process is paused the text "Paused" will appear and the settings of the active ethernet interface. Pressing F1 again will resume the boot process.
When using a connected PS/2 keyboard press (and release) the F1 key twice while booting in order to enter the paused state. Pressing F1 once will resume the boot process.

Changes in firmware 1.7.2 (954):
--------------------------------

- Bugfix: The number of ARP entries was increased from 20 to 40. The NLSR can thus resolve up to 40 IP addresses and implement a inter-system communication with one master station, 32 substations and seven other network devices.

- The input MSWC #1 E4 (closed current loop) can be used to configure a circuit shutdown of the station. The circuit shutdown is carried out when the input E=0 is permanently present. When switched off, the circuits are unpowerd and function/capacity tests are locked. In the LCD the menu item "reset errors" will also terminate the shutdown after confirmation.
A running function or capacity test is terminated as soon as possible.

- Mixed MCHG revisions with old (up HW6) and new MCHG (from HW7, SW35), which may result in MCHG not charging the battery, are detected and displayed as "MCHG versions" fault. All MCHG must have either a software version of SW35 (or higher) or SW19 (or lower, SW18 is displayed as SW33).

- Revised  battery symmetry monitoring: The symmetry deviation delta_v = (V_bat + - 2 * V_Batsym) in the battery symmetry is communicated in regular intervals (about 60 seconds) to all MCHG. The battery charging voltage is adjusted accordingly. 

- Adjustable error threshold for symmetry deviation (OEM page). The default deviation is set to the value 50 (+ -2.5 V).

- The external battery temperature sensor in the battery compartment is actively monitored. If the sensor does not provide readings or readings below 10C or above 50C results in a  corresponding fault. The function of the sensor (temperature readings) must be checked after a firmware update.

- When no function or capacity test can be triggered, "test locked" is displayed on the status screen. Locking occurs on following conditions:
  - deep discharge
  - faulty battery fuse
  - low battery voltage ( <230V)
  - active strong charge (MCHG)
  - mains failure in an UVC (sub distribution)
  - active (mains) (modified standby) state in an UVC (sub distribution)

- The page admin/anlage.html has two buttons to operate the Web-BAS in order to turn the system into "operational" or "off (charging)". The state of BAS-switch, MSWC input and MCT-BAS is displayed. In order to turn the CBS "operational" all BAS-sources have to be in state "operational".
  The BAS-switch has priority over the Web-BAS and resets the Web-BAS to "operational" (BAS reset) when executing the sequence "operational -> off (charging) -> operational" on the switch.
  In case of a  NLSR (Z1) failure the system changes to "operational" 
  Requirement: Z2 with SW34 or higher
